Interpretation
What this quote means
Success in business hinges more on the mindset of the entrepreneur or investor than on the business opportunity itself.
This quote by Robert Kiyosaki emphasizes that every business or investment opportunity can be worthwhile, but the success of an entrepreneur or investor is largely determined by their emotional resilience and mindset. It suggests that winning and losing are inevitable aspects of the entrepreneurial journey, and a successful individual must maintain an emotionally neutral stance towards these outcomes, focusing instead on their ambitions and how they cope with setbacks.
